1. Specifications Comparison
Design
Feature | Xiaomi Mi 10T 5G | Motorola Edge 30 Fusion |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Dimensions | 165.1 × 76.4 × 9.3 mm | 158.5 × 72 × 7.5 mm | Mi 10T 5G is larger and bulkier, less pocketable and comfortable for smaller hands. Edge 30 Fusion is slimmer and easier to handle. |
Weight | 216g | 168g | Mi 10T 5G feels significantly heavier, less comfortable for extended use. Edge 30 Fusion is lighter and more comfortable. |
Build Quality (Screen Protection) | Corning Gorilla Glass 5 | Unknown | Mi 10T 5G offers better screen protection against scratches and drops. |
Display
Feature | Xiaomi Mi 10T 5G | Motorola Edge 30 Fusion |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Size | 6.67" | 6.55" | Slightly larger screen on Mi 10T 5G, marginally more immersive for media consumption. |
Technology | IPS LCD | P-OLED | Edge 30 Fusion offers superior contrast, deeper blacks, and more vibrant colors due to P-OLED technology. |
Resolution | 1080x2400 | 1080x2400 | Identical sharpness. |
Refresh Rate | 144Hz | 144Hz | Both offer very smooth scrolling and gaming experience. |
Brightness | 0 nits | 1100 nits | Edge 30 Fusion is much more usable outdoors in bright sunlight due to significantly higher brightness. Note: The 0 nits brightness reported for the Mi 10T 5G is likely a data error. |
Performance
Feature | Xiaomi Mi 10T 5G | Motorola Edge 30 Fusion |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Chipset | Qualcomm Snapdragon 865 5G (7 nm+) | Qualcomm Snapdragon 888+ 5G (5 nm) | Edge 30 Fusion offers faster processing and better overall performance for demanding tasks and gaming. |
AnTuTu Score | 742,400 | 904,900 | Edge 30 Fusion provides a smoother and more responsive user experience. |
GPU | Adreno 650 | Adreno 660 | Edge 30 Fusion handles graphics-intensive applications and games better. |
RAM | 6GB/8GB | 8GB/12GB | Edge 30 Fusion allows for better multitasking and smoother running of multiple apps simultaneously, especially with the 12GB option. |
Camera
Feature | Xiaomi Mi 10T 5G | Motorola Edge 30 Fusion |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Main Camera | 64MP, f/1.89, 1/1.7" | 50MP, f/1.8, 1/1.55" | Mi 10T 5G has higher resolution, but Edge 30 Fusion has a larger sensor and wider aperture, potentially better low-light performance and image quality. |
Selfie Camera | 20MP, f/2.4, 1/3.4" | 32MP, f/2.2 | Edge 30 Fusion captures more detailed and brighter selfies. |
Wide Angle Lens | 13MP, f/2.4, 1/3.06" | 13MP, f/2.2 | Edge 30 Fusion's wider aperture potentially captures brighter wide-angle shots. |
Macro Lens | 5MP | None | Mi 10T 5G can take dedicated macro shots, though quality may vary. |
Portrait Mode (Depth) | None | 2MP | Edge 30 Fusion can take dedicated portrait shots with more depth. |
Optical Image Stabilization (OIS) | No | Yes | Edge 30 Fusion produces smoother videos and sharper photos, especially in low light. |
Video Recording | Up to 8K@60fps | Up to 8K@30fps | Both record high-resolution video, but Mi 10T 5G offers 8K@60fps. |
Battery
Feature | Xiaomi Mi 10T 5G | Motorola Edge 30 Fusion |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Capacity | 5000mAh | 4400mAh | Mi 10T 5G offers longer battery life on a single charge. |
Charging | 33W | 68W | Edge 30 Fusion charges much faster, reducing downtime. |
Other
Feature | Xiaomi Mi 10T 5G | Motorola Edge 30 Fusion |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Operating System | Android 10 (upgradeable to 11) | Android 12 (upgradeable to 13) | Edge 30 Fusion has a more up-to-date OS and longer software support. |
Bluetooth | 5.1 | 5.2 | Edge 30 Fusion has the latest Bluetooth version for slightly improved connectivity and efficiency. |
Storage Options | 128GB | 128GB/256GB | Edge 30 Fusion offers a 256GB option for users needing more storage. |
Audio | Stereo Speakers | Dolby Atmos, Stereo Speakers | Edge 30 Fusion provides a more immersive and high-quality audio experience. |
Sensors | Ultrasonic proximity virtual | Proximity | Xiaomi features Ultrasonic proximity virtual and Motorola features proximity |
2. Key Differences Analysis
Xiaomi Mi 10T 5G Advantages:
- Larger Battery: Offers longer battery life for users who prioritize endurance.
- Macro Lens: Dedicated macro lens for close-up photography.
Practical Implications: The Mi 10T 5G is suitable for users who need a phone that can last all day and appreciate macro photography.
Motorola Edge 30 Fusion Advantages:
- Superior Display: P-OLED screen provides better visual quality with vibrant colors and deep blacks.
- Faster Performance: Snapdragon 888+ chipset offers better performance for gaming and demanding applications.
- Faster Charging: 68W charging significantly reduces charging time.
- Better Camera (Overall): Larger main camera sensor, wider apertures, OIS, and better selfie camera contribute to improved image and video quality.
- More Modern Software: Comes with a newer version of Android and is likely to receive updates for a longer period.
- Lighter and Slimmer Design: More comfortable to hold and carry.
- Dolby Atmos Audio: Better audio quality for media consumption.
Practical Implications: The Edge 30 Fusion is a better choice for users who prioritize display quality, performance, camera capabilities, and a modern software experience.
Trade-offs:
- Mi 10T 5G trades performance and display quality for longer battery life and a macro camera.
- Edge 30 Fusion trades some battery capacity for significantly faster charging and better overall user experience.
